Good deal. I got mind at Best Buy for 399$ after rebate, and I love it even at that price. I was worried about ghosting as I play ALOT of games, from FPS to MMORPG to RTS. Pretty much anything you can imagine. After spending a few days gaming and watching movies on this panel, I have to say I am very impressed and extremely pleased. It is sharp, color reproduction is exemplary, and there is NO ghosting whatsoever in games or movies.

I have it hooked up to the DVI of my Geforce 6800 and it looks great! IMHO no reason to buy a 2001fp for 600 when you can get this for 379

Originally posted by: estew33
Originally posted by: PoxMeister
Cool, thx for the reply. I do have a VGA to DVI adapter that came with a Radeon 9800 Pro. If I use that, will it provide the same quality DVI connection to the monitor, the same as if I were using an actual DVI ended cable?

Good Question, anyone know the answer

No it will not since you are still using the Analog signal.
There are 2 types of DVI called DVI-I and DVI-D. The DVI-I has pins for the standard VGA signal and the DVI-D has not.

Originally posted by: auto
I've been using analog on my lcd and have not tried DVI, is there noticeable difference ?

I started using the VGA cable but then a friend gave me his spare DVI cable so I have seen both. The nice thing about DVI is that you don't have to do any setting on the monitor (width, height, etc). It completely users the whole screen. I think the picture was clearer too. Its a great monitor for HL2 and such (its what Im currently playing on)
